You'll have to make some brackets up and also may have to lengthen the wiring to the DFI module.
F.I.T supply a pair of aluminium brackets with their A2A intercooler kit to relocate the coils down beside the pass extractors to suit VT-VY's but that's probably where you don't want them.

i just got a bit of 65mm(i think just measure between the 2 bolts on the bottom of the coil pack) equal angle, and drilled holes 2 suit the bottom of the coil pack on one side then 2 holes 2 suit the 2 bolts at the front of the brake booster, just switch the leads over and extend the loom, and i used some heat sheild around it.
